What Is Organic Fertility?

Organic fertility refers to the use of natural soil amendments and biological inputs to maintain and improve soil nutrients.
Unlike synthetic fertilisers, organic fertility inputs:
  • Release nutrients slowly
  • Improve soil organic matter.
  • Support beneficial microorganisms
  • Increase long-term soil health.
Farmers using organic fertility programs often see better soil resilience and improved crop performance.

Types of Organic Fertility Products

Organic fertility inputs can include a variety of soil improvement materials.

Organic Soil Amendments

Organic soil amendments improve soil health and nutrient retention.
Examples include:
  • Compost-based fertilizers
  • Organic mineral supplements
  • Natural soil conditioners
  • Biological soil enhancers
These products support better root development and nutrient availability.

Organic Plant Nutrition Inputs

Organic farming systems rely on plant nutrition sources derived from natural materials.
Common examples include:
  • Organic nitrogen sources
  • Natural phosphorus inputs
  • Organic potassium sources
  • Trace mineral supplements
These nutrients support balanced plant growth without synthetic chemicals.

Soil Microbial Enhancers

Healthy soil biology is essential for organic farming systems. Microbial inputs help stimulate natural soil processes.
Benefits include:
  • Improved nutrient cycling
  • Better soil structure
  • Enhanced root growth
  • Stronger plant resilience
